The journey from McLean to Indianapolis covers approximately 230 miles via I-74 East. Driving is the most practical method, typically taking 3 hours and 30 minutes depending on traffic near the Indianapolis beltway. You will pass through Champaign and Danville before crossing the state line into Indiana. There is no direct rail service from McLean, making personal vehicle travel the standard choice. The route is largely flat, traversing the heart of the Midwest corn belt.
